New Research on Hormonal IUD as Effective Contraception

Research from the University of Utah and Planned Parenthood shows evidence that the hormonal intrauterine device or LNG-IUD is an effective option for both long-term and emergency contraception. Dr. Kirtly Parker Jones speaks with Dr. David Turok and what his team’s research means for women and OBGYN practice.

Methods like intrauterine devices and implants have nearly doubled in popularity among women using birth control in recent years, the federal government reported.

Intrauterine devices (IUDs) just got a big seal of approval, this time from the American Academy of Pediatrics, which recently endorsed them as an excellent method to prevent teenage pregnancy... add to that the fact that it's also the most commonly used birth control among doctors themselves.

A copper IUD is an intrauterine device with a plastic frame and a fine copper wire. It is a non-hormonal form of birth control, in contrast to the Kyleena IUD. The contraceptive is placed into the uterus, where a fine nylon thread extends from the cervix to the top of the vagina to prevent pregnancy.
